Weather

We know we aren’t the first to tell you that the weather will be a large factor in choosing your wedding date. Why do you think fall and spring weddings are so popular?! Even though fall and spring weddings take the cake for your typical beautiful weather, winter and summer weddings are nothing to turn your nose up at.

No matter the season, the weather will always have an impact on your wedding day. At any venue you choose, normal environmental factors will occur. In the fall, the leaves will change color and drop from the trees, winter will have some barren trees and fewer blooms, spring will likely be rainy or unexpectedly cold, and summer will get HOT. To help navigate these decisions, sit down with your partner and decide what you envision for your wedding day. Make a list of your must-haves for your wedding day and imagine how the weather fits into that. Dreaming of a bright outdoor ceremony? Spring or Fall is probably for you! Do you love the elegant vibe of fur and velvet? You sound like a winter bride!

Pricing

Any wedding venue that you go to tour is going to vary its pricing by date. Everyone’s breakdown is different but go into wedding planning knowing that some dates will be more expensive than others.

For example, at The Springs, we base our pricing around peak-wedding months. This means that our pricing is higher during specific months of the year, varying by location. So by booking a date in the non-peak months, you are already looking at some incredible discounts! Additionally, we vary the pricing by the day of the week. Photography

If your wedding photos are of utmost importance to you, consider this when you are choosing your wedding date. Seasonality, weather, and lighting are all affected by your wedding date.

For example, if your wedding date is during daylight savings time, you have an extra hour of sunlight in the evening to take portraits. Plus, who doesn’t love every second of golden hour?! Additionally, many photographers have more availability during the non-peak wedding months, the same as venues. This could even affect their pricing as well.
